The state of Arizona presented Michael G. Tafoya with a law license in 1998 after he graduated from Arizona State University Law School.
The Arizona State Bar found Mike guilty of the following misconduct.
- Failed to maintain current address with State Bar as required
- Failed to comply with court scheduling order
- Obstructed opposing party’s attempt to comply with court scheduling order
- Asserted issue wherein there wasn’t a good faith basis in law or fact
- Failed to act with due diligence (slacker)
- Failed to communicate with client
- Failed to expedite litigation
- Engaged in conduct prejudicial to the administration of justice
